概括
这项研究为COVID-19测试设施的选择引入了新的图片立方体模糊几何聚合运算符. 这些新型运营商在不确定的环境中增强了多标准集团决策 (MCGDM).

背景情况:
- 信息聚合对于决策至关重要,特别是对于复杂的数据结构,如立方体和图像模糊数.
- 图像立方体模糊集提供了一个通用的框架来管理决策问题中增加的不确定性和模糊性.
研究的目的:
- 为图片立方体模糊信息引入新的哈马切尔几何聚合运算符.
- 开发和应用使用这些运营商选择COVID-19测试设施的多标准组决策 (MCGDM) 算法.
主要方法:
- 图像立方模糊的哈马切尔加权的几何,混合几何和顺序加权的几何聚合运算符的开发.
- 探索这些新定义的运算符的特性.
- 为图像立方体模糊环境量身定制的MCGDM算法的构建.
主要成果:
- 拟议的聚合运营商在处理图像立方体模糊信息方面表现出有效性.
- 开发的MCGDM算法成功选择了一个真实的实验室进行COVID-19测试.
- 对比分析证实了拟议运营商在现有方法上的优势.
结论:
- 新的图片立方模糊的哈马切尔几何聚合运算符对于MCGDM问题是有效的.
- 拟议的方法为在不确定性中选择COVID-19测试设施提供了一个强大的方法.
- 这项研究在现实世界决策场景中推进了模糊集合理论的应用.

Pareto Chart
6.7K
A Pareto chart is a bar graph or a combination of both line and bar graphs. The bar lengths represent the individual values or the frequency, while the lines represent the cumulative total values. In this chart, the longest bars are arranged on the left and the shortest bars on the right, which makes it easier to read and interpret the data. It can also be called a Pareto diagram or Pareto analysis.

Pie Chart
14.1K
A pie chart (or a pie graph) is a circular graphical chart or a pictorial representation of categorical data. It is divided into slices of pie each indicating numerical proportions. It is also used to show the relative sizes of data in a single chart.
In a pie chart, the central angle, the arc length of each slice, and the area are directly proportional to the quantity or percentage it represents. Some real-world examples that can be depicted using pie charts include marks obtained by students...
